1. Important Safety Information

WARNING!
Before installing and using the Inverter, you need to read
following safety information carefully.

1-1. General Safety Precautions

1-1-1. Do not expose the Inverter to water, mist, snow, or dust. To reduce the

risk of hazard, do not cover or obstruct the ventilation shaft.

Do not install the Inverter in a zero-clearance compartment.

Overheating may occur.

1-1-2. To avoid the risk of fire and electronic shock, make sure that existing

wiring is in good electrical condition and not undersize.

Do not operate the Inverter with damaged or substandard Wiring.

1-1-3. There are some components in the inverter can cause arcs and sparks.

To prevent from fire or explosion, do not put batteries, flammable

materials, or anything should be ignition–protected around the inverter.

1-2. Precautions When Working with Batteries

1-2-1. If battery acid contacts your skin or clothing, you need to wash it out

immediately with soap and water. If acid enters into your eyes,

immediately flush your eyes with running cold water for at least 20

minutes and get medical attention immediately.

1-2-2. Never smoke or make a spark or flame in the vicinity of batteries or

Engines.

1-2-3. Do not drop a metal tools on the battery. The resulting spark or short-

circuit on the battery or other electrical parts may cause an explosion.

1-2-4. Remove personal metal items such as rings, bracelets, necklaces, and

watches when working with a lead-acid battery,

A lead-acid battery may produce a short-circuit current who’s

temperature is high enough to weld these metal items and cause a

severe burn.
